Abstract:
In this article the solution of dynamical equation of motion of IBM-Ⅱ in continuous variable representation is discussed.With appropriate transformation and approximation,the on-phase part of system manifests the vibration-rotation mode and the off-phase part the 'scissor mode',ect.In the last section the energy spectrum of 156Gd is calculated.The result can well reproduce the algebraic result of IBM-Ⅱ.
